Description
Party game.
The host places syllables all round the room. Players are instructed to find three syllables that make up the name of a British town; e.g. Ed-in-burgh. There are 33 towns listed on the host's Key Card, all made up of three syllables.
If you can make a town out of the syllables, you take it to the host who records you with 1 success and he will put the cards back in the box. Then the successful player goes back to the room to see if he can find another town.
After an agreed time, the player who found the most, wins.
